Another fantastic ongoing discussion at fantastic ColumbiaMagazine.com: Kentucky soft drinks of the early 20th century. There's Dope Cola and Dope Grape out of Campbellsville, either My-Coca or My-Cola of Columbia and My Coca of Lexington.
